CVE-2018-14947 is a high-severity memory management vulnerability (CWE-119) affecting PDF2JSON 0.69, specifically within the XmlFontAccu::CSStyle function in XmlFonts.cc, due to mismatched memory routines. This flaw allows for remote code execution with high imp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ability, requiring user interaction for exploitation. While rated 8.8 CVSSv3.0, there is no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code (Metasploit, Nuclei, ExploitDB), or significant community discussion or media coverage.
